Quote:
Originally Posted by Stingray View Post
Oh Definatley getting some blue actinics in there, just gonna use 4 to 6 bulbs for now while its cycleing and a fowlr, then add when 6-8months old along with a anemone or 2...
Dont get 2 - one is more then enough, anemone are quite difficult to look after!!

Carful if you are only going to run so many bulbs at first - as evaporation can get into the ballasts of the ones with out bulbs. Cover them up with clingfilm tightly!! - Probably just easier to run all the bulbs!
